Abstract

The invention discloses a key switch with a lamp and an assembly method of the key switch with the lamp. The key switch with the lamp comprises a base seat, a static contact, a moving contact, an upper lid and a key, wherein a hanging table is arranged on the key, and a through groove, a first giving-way groove, a second giving-way groove and a moving groove are formed in the upper lid. When the key switch with the lamp is assembled, firstly, the hanging table is aligned with the second giving-way groove and the key is pressed downwards so that the key enters the first giving-way groove and the through groove; then the key is moved laterally to enable the hanging table to enter the moving groove, and therefore the key is enabled to totally enter the through groove; and finally, when the upper lid and the base seat are assembled, a first filling block and a second filling block are respectively embedded in the first giving-way groove and the second giving-way groove, and therefore fast assembly of the key switch with the lamp is achieved. The key switch with the lamp and the assembly method of the key switch with the lamp are simple in structure, ingenious and easy to assemble, few in technological process of production, beneficial to the improvement of production efficiency and reduction of manufacturing cost, easy in bulk order production, capable of meeting market demands and small in part quantity so that the stability of electrical performance and mechanical performance can be guaranteed, and the quality of the key switch with the lamp is greatly improved.

Background technology
At present, key switch is widely used in the various fields such as instrument, instrument, Medical Devices, electric power system, industrial automatic control, traditional key switch user in operating process can't judge this key switch On/Off state intuitively, therefore the puzzlement of can doubling when the user operates.At present, some key switches with lamp occurred on the market, it is generally indicator light to be embedded in the lateral margin of switch housing, and the light skewness on keycap that so makes indicator light send can not make the keycap entirely lighting; Especially, existing key switch with lamp is because of complex structure, the technological process of production is various, because of the many scattered assembling difficulties that cause of parts, cause that production efficiency is low, cost is high, Batch orders is produced difficulty, is difficult to meet the need of market, and parts how easily to cause electric, mechanical performance is unstable, directly affects the quality of manufacturing enterprise and demand enterprise.

Embodiment
Please refer to Fig. 1 to shown in Figure 9, the concrete structure that it has demonstrated the present invention's preferred embodiment, the button 50 that includes pedestal 10, static contact 20, movable contact spring 30, upper cover 40 and contact or separate for control movable contact spring 30 and static contact 20.
Wherein, this static contact 20 and movable contact spring 30 all are arranged on pedestal 10, the welding foot 21 of this static contact 20 and the welding foot 31 of movable contact spring 30 all stretch out outside pedestal 10 downwards, this movable contact spring 30 has elastic contact part 32, this elastic contact part 32 is positioned at pedestal 10, be provided with two arch portions 321 and on this elastic contact part 32 for the contact 322 that contacts with static contact 20, this contact 322 is between this two arch portion 321; This upper cover 40 is installed on pedestal 10, and this button 50 is arranged on pedestal 10 and upwards exposes upper cover 40, and the top and bottom of this button 50 all are square, and button 50 upper end width are greater than the width of button 50 lower ends.
As shown in Figure 9, the lower end lateral surface convex of this button 50 is provided with hanging platform 51, this button 50 has a hollow containing cavity 52, be provided with two pressure sections 53 for the arch portion 321 that compresses aforementioned correspondence for aforementioned two arch portions 321 convex on a side of button 50, in the present embodiment, when button 50 presses down, this pressure section 53 acts on corresponding arch portion 321 and impels contact 322 to leave static contact 20, when button 50 upwards resets, aforementioned elastic contact part 32 resets, and makes contact 322 contact conducting with static contact 20.
As shown in Figure 8, be provided with button 50 suitablely for the up and down groove 41 of button 50 on this upper cover 40, aforementioned hanging platform 51 is used for button 50 is limited in groove 41, breaks away from grooves 41 to prevent button 50; The lateral margin of this groove 41 offers for coordinating button 50 is installed on groove 41 interior the first slot to make way 42 and the second slot to make way 43, this first slot to make way 42 all is communicated with groove 41 with the second slot to make way 43, and be provided with confession hanging platform 51 on the internal face of this groove 41 and be displaced sideways so that button 50 is assembled into the loose slot 44 in groove 41 fully, this loose slot 44 is communicated with the second slot to make way 43; In the present embodiment, on the two relative side of aforementioned keys 50, equal convex is provided with an aforementioned hanging platform 51, so that button 50 is stressed evenly, to should be provided with two aforementioned the second slots to make way 43 and two aforementioned loose slots 44 by each hanging platform 51 on upper cover 40, this two loose slot 44 is communicated with corresponding the second slot to make way 43.
as shown in Figure 7, the center of this pedestal 10 is convex to be provided with for the up and down hollow guide pillar 11 of guiding button 50, this hollow guide pillar 11 is suitable and be inserted into from lower to upper in hollow containing cavity 52 with aforementioned hollow containing cavity 52, in this hollow guide pillar 11, indicator light 60 is installed, in the present embodiment, this indicator light 60 is the RGB three-color LED light, but be not limited to the RGB three-color LED light, also can be other various forms of indicator lights, the connecting pin 61 of this indicator light 60 stretches out downwards outside the bottom centre of pedestal 10, in the present embodiment, the interior one-body molded cross locating rack 12 that is useful on positioning light 60 of this hollow guide pillar 11, the lamp body 62 of this indicator light 60 is positioned at the upper surface of cross locating rack 12, four connecting pins 61 of this indicator light 60 are separated by this cross locating rack 12, and, the lateral margin one of this pedestal 10 has upwards protruded out the first filling block 13 and the second filling block 14, this first filling block 13 and the first slot to make way 42 are suitable and be inlaid in from lower to upper in the first slot to make way 42, this second filling block 14 and the second slot to make way 43 are suitable and be inlaid in from lower to upper in the second slot to make way 43, in the present embodiment, have two aforementioned the second filling blocks 14 on this pedestal 10, this two second filling block 14 corresponding insertion respectively is inlaid in the second slot to make way 43 of aforementioned correspondence, in addition, be provided with guide channel 15 on the madial wall of this pedestal 10, this guide channel 15 is positioned at by the side of the second filling block 14, and this guide channel 15 is communicated with aforementioned loose slot 44, and this hanging platform 51 is suitable and be embedded in guide channel 15 and up and down along guide channel 15 with guide channel 15.
Be provided with the spring 70 that resets be used to impelling button 50 to pop up for aforementioned keys 50, this spring 70 is set in outside aforementioned hollow guide pillar 11, and the two ends up and down of spring 70 are butted on respectively on button and pedestal, in the present embodiment, be provided with the first location notch 16 on this pedestal 10, this the first location notch 16 is positioned at the periphery of hollow guide pillar 11, the lower end of this spring 70 is embedded in location in this first location notch 16, be provided with the second location notch 54 on this button 50, the upper end of this spring 70 is embedded in location in this second location notch 54.
And the upper end open capping of this button 50 has scattering sheet 80, this scattering sheet 80 be positioned at aforementioned indicator light 60 directly over, the intensity of illumination distribution that utilizes this scattering sheet 80 can make indicator light 60 send is more even, seven color effects are better.
In addition, in the present embodiment, fasten each other to install by buckle portion 101 and button hole 102 between this upper cover 40 and pedestal 10 and connect, specifically say, the two relative side lower end of this upper cover 40 all is arranged at intervals with two aforementioned button holes 102, equal interval, the two relative side upper end convex of this pedestal 10 is provided with two aforementioned buckle portions 101 accordingly, and those buckle portions 101 fasten each other with corresponding button hole 102, makes upper cover 40 and pedestal 10 be connected to each other and is installed together.
In addition, extend downwards the bottom surface of this pedestal 10 a plurality of reference columns 17, and these a plurality of reference columns 17 are used for making pedestal 10 and outside to realize location and installation.
The assembling process that the present embodiment is described in detail in detail is as follows:
Include following steps:
(1) as depicted in figs. 1 and 2, static contact 20 and movable contact spring 30 are assembled on pedestal 10 from top to bottom, the welding foot 21 of static contact 20 and the welding foot 31 of movable contact spring 30 are all stretched out outside pedestal 10, and indicator light 60 is assembled in hollow guide pillar 11 from top to bottom, the connecting pin 61 of indicator light 60 is stretched out outside pedestal 10;
(2) spring 70 is set in outside hollow guide pillar 11;
(3) as shown in Figure 3 and Figure 4, the hanging platform 51 of button 50 is aimed at the second slot to make way 43 and button 50 inserted from top to bottom in the groove 41 and the first slot to make way 42 of upper cover 40, after insertion puts in place, as shown in Figure 5, button 50 is displaced sideways, make hanging platform 51 enter the tail end of loose slot 44, thereby make button 50 be assembled into fully in groove 41;
(4) upper cover 40 is mounted on pedestal 10 from top to bottom, meanwhile, this hollow guide pillar 11 inserts in hollow containing cavity 52, this first filling block 13 and the second filling block 14 be corresponding the insertion in the first slot to make way 42 and the second slot to make way 43 respectively, this spring 70 is butted on button 50, assembles complete (as shown in Figure 1).
During use, this indicator light 60 can be in normal bright state or can contact with movable contact spring 30 or conducting changes with static contact 20; When pressing this button 50, this pressure section 53 acts on corresponding arch portion 321 and impels contact 322 to leave static contact 20, disconnects thereby make between static contact 200 and movable contact spring 30; When unclamping button 50, this button 50 upwards resets under the effect of spring 70 automatically, makes elastic contact part 32 reset, thereby makes contact 322 contact conducting with static contact 20.
